Output 6efbecd051338bb5a389f782fa26b19a55c732c34fc81e74bbe39e992fe6b28d:3

value
12748983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45fc4785b5753884620db409d5620987de6fcfe OP_EQUAL
address
3J8kH7WkH8HapV91LeEngctXC4SUuKh8ko
transaction
6efbecd051338bb5a389f782fa26b19a55c732c34fc81e74bbe39e992fe6b28d
spent
true